Analysis
Yemen recorded -24.21 % change on previous year for nutrient potash k2o (total) — import quantity, annual growth rate in 2023.
That represents a change of down 449.2% on the previous year and up 55.1% over ten years.
Over the whole period, nutrient potash k2o (total) — import quantity, annual growth rate in Yemen peaked at 788.89 % change on previous year in 1977 and was at its lowest, -100 % change on previous year, in 1996.
That places Yemen 173rd out of 212 countries with data for 2023, putting it in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
The year-on-year percentage change in Nutrient potash K2O (total) — Import quantity.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
Computed from
- Nutrient potash K2O (total) — Import quantity Food and Agriculture Organization of the United Nations
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
